Weather in January

January, like December, in Gwelutshena, Zimbabwe, is a moderately hot summer month, with an average temperature varying between 28.5°C (83.3°F) and 19°C (66.2°F).

Temperature

Gwelutshena marks the arrival of January with an average high-temperature of a still moderately hot 28.5°C (83.3°F), hardly different from December's 29.7°C (85.5°F). Gwelutshena cools down to an average low-temperature of 19°C (66.2°F) throughout the month of January.

Humidity

In Gwelutshena, Zimbabwe, the average relative humidity in January is 74%.

Rainfall

The month with the most rainfall is January, when the rain falls for 25.9 days and typically aggregates up to 181mm (7.13") of precipitation.

Daylight

In Gwelutshena, Zimbabwe, the average length of the day in January is 13h and 7min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 05:31 and sunset at 18:45. On the last day of January, sunrise is at 05:50 and sunset at 18:46 CAT.

Sunshine

In Gwelutshena, the average sunshine in January is 10.2h.

Average temperature in January
Gwelutshena, Zimbabwe
  • Average high temperature in January: 28.5°C

The warmest month (with the highest average high temperature) is October (33.8°C).
The month with the lowest average high temperature is June (23.9°C).

  • Average low temperature in January: 19°C

The month with the highest average low temperature is November (20.7°C).
The coldest month (with the lowest average low temperature) is July (10.8°C).

Average humidity in January
Gwelutshena, Zimbabwe
  • Average humidity in January: 74%

The month with the highest relative humidity is February (76%).
The month with the lowest relative humidity is September (30%).

Average rainfall in January
Gwelutshena, Zimbabwe
  • Average rainfall in January: 181mm

The wettest month (with the highest rainfall) is January (181mm).
The driest month (with the least rainfall) is August (0mm).

Average rainfall days in January
Gwelutshena, Zimbabwe
  • Average rainfall days in January: 25.9 days

The month with the highest number of rainy days is January (25.9 days).
The month with the least rainy days is August (0.5 days).
